Vodka sauce has always been a staple of Italian cooking. The alcohol brings out flavors normally unaccessible in the dish. Italians normally use a regular potato vodka for this, but using Corbin Sweet Potato Vodka gives the dish a sweetness that is not normally present in the dish. Combined with farfalle pasta (bowties) or penne and some freshly grated Parmigiano Reggiano, this is a fantastic dish to serve over the holidays. Ingredients • ½ cup butter • 1 medium onion, diced • 1 cup Corbin Sweet Potato Vodka • 2 28 oz. cans crushed tomatoes (Muir Glen brand if possible) • 1 pint heavy cream In a skillet over medium heat, saute onion in butter until slightly brown and soft. Pour in vodka and let cook for 10 minutes. Mix in crushed tomatoes and cook for 30 minutes. Pour in heavy cream and cook for another 30 minutes.
